Comprehending Three-Phase UPS Technology and its Benefits

Three-phase UPS systems provide a vital layer of protection for industrial equipment and facilities that operate on three-phase power. Unlike single-phase UPS, which are typically used for consumer electronics or small office networks, three-phase UPS units address the higher power demands of complex machinery, ensuring seamless operation even during outages.

One major benefit of three-phase UPS is their ability to provide stable power to critical equipment. This prevents data loss, production downtime, and potential damage to sensitive hardware. Furthermore, they offer advanced features like voltage regulation and harmonic filtering, which improve the overall consistency of the power supply.

  • Because of their robust construction and high-capacity batteries, three-phase UPS units can provide extended runtime during outages, allowing for a graceful shutdown or continued operation of critical processes.

Securing Reliable Power Protection: Choosing the Right Three-Phase UPS System for Your UK Operation

In today's unpredictable business landscape, steadfastness is paramount. For UK operations relying on three-phase power, a robust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) system is essential. A well-selected UPS protects your equipment and data from power outages, ensuring continuous operation even during energy emergencies.

When procuring a three-phase UPS, consider factors such as your load profile. Determine the kVA rating required to power your critical equipment. Also, consider the runtime duration you need during a power outage.

Deploy a UPS system that offers robust protection features like surge mitigation, voltage regulation, and battery redundancy. Additionally, emphasize a system with user-friendly dashboard for easy management and troubleshooting.
